Meaning & usage

pron[ˈmeː]Classical-Latin[ˈmɛː]
  1. me, myself; accusative singular of ego

    personal · pronoun
  2. by me, with me, from me; ablative singular of ego

    personal · pronoun
Where this word comes from

From a merger of: * Proto-Italic *mē, accusative of *egō; from Proto-Indo-European *h₁mé, accusative of *éǵh₂ (“I”) * Proto-Italic *med, from Proto-Indo-European *h₁méd, the corresponding ablative singular. Cognate with Ancient Greek με (me), ἐμέ (emé, “me”), Sanskrit मा (mā, “me”), Old English me, Gothic 𐌼𐌹𐌺 (mik), Old Irish mé, Proto-Slavic *mene (Old Church Slavonic мене (mene), Russian меня́ (menjá)), Lithuanian mi, Albanian mua.
